What Are Rain Gutters and Why Are They Essential for a House?
Rain gutters are ditches or narrow channels fixed around a roof’s corner.
Not all houses or buildings need gutters, but most homes have them.
Their foremost purpose is to gather and direct water away from your house's base.
Gutters assist avoid water harm to a residence's exterior and interior while guarding it from structural problems resulting from long-term water damage.
How Often Should Rain Gutters Be Cleaned to Prevent Obstructions and Water Harm?
Ideally, house owners should maintain their gutters twice a year at minimum, once in the spring and once in the fall; however, the twice-yearly schedule isn’t a rigid guideline.
For example, homeowners with trees near their homes might want to service their rain gutters more often to prevent clogs caused by leaves or waste.
It’s a wise notion to maintain gutters regularly to prevent spillage or leakage that can lead to water deterioration.

What Are the Usual Indicators of Gutter Deterioration?
There are quite a few common signs that show a home's gutter needs fixing that include but are not limited to the following:
- Leakage - Householders may notice water dripping or flowing from their rain gutters rather than being properly diverted away from their houses
- Rusting - Noticeable corrosion in the form of scaly spots or russet discolorations can point to that the metal component of the gutters is degrading or thinning.
- Drooping - Rain gutters should be securely fastened to the roof line. If they are pulling away or sagging, they might not be able to carry out their chief duty.
- Flaking Paint - Rain gutters with paint or layer that’s flaking off need fixing to make sure the metal underneath does not oxidize or degrade.
- Accumulated Water - Water accumulating at or near a house’s foundation can signify the rain gutters are not doing their duty.
- Impaired Landscaping - Fungus, degradation, harm to trees or lawns, and plant decay can all point to rain gutters that need restoration.
What Are the Different Kinds of Rain Gutters Available?
The four varied types of gutters are:
- K-style - This is one of the most preferred kinds and are clearly recognizable by their level backsides and rectangular spouts. K-style rain gutters are easily put in but challenging to clean.
- Half-Round - This is another one of the most favored types and has a semicircular design with round downspouts. Half-round gutters are durable but vulnerable to debris. They are also more expensive to mount.
- Custom Fascia - As the name might imply, this type is a custom-built seamless drainage system that connects to a house’s fascia board. It has a larger design for heavier water flow; however, custom fascia gutters are costly and challenging to put in.
- Box-Style - This type of drainage system is gigantic and has a high back section that settles under roof shingles. It is resilient and can manage heavy water flow, but it costly and is devoid of visual allure.

What Are the Kinds of Materials Used For Gutters?
There are different forms of materials used in rain gutters with the most usual being vinyl and aluminum. These materials include:
- Vinyl - Vinyl gutters are straightforward to mount; however, they are not the most durable and have a lifespan averaging 10 to 20 years.
- Aluminum - Aluminum gutters are rust-resistant and lightweight. They have a life expectancy of 20-30 years on average but have a elevated hazard of cracking.
- Galvanized Steel - Galvanized steel gutters are sturdy and long-lasting, but in most cases, they will necessitate specialized installation. These rain gutters last 20-30 years but call for regular upkeep to stop oxidation.
- Zinc - Zinc rain gutters are resistant to rust and minimal upkeep. They are remarkably durable, with most zinc rain gutters averaging lifespans of 80 years or more.
- Copper - Copper rain gutters are the most costly option, but they can be quite valuable. They need expert setup and do not twist or oxidize.
What Kind of Finish is Used for Rain Gutters?
Rain gutters don’t always need to be painted yet when they do, it should be with paint specifically designed for outdoor and metal areas.
For this purpose, oil-based coating tends to work the best since they are robust, durable, and can withstand persistent exposure to the elements.
It’s also a wise idea to prime the rain gutters beforehand to painting them.
Can Severe Weather Conditions Harm Rain Gutters?
Yes. Severe weather situations like heavy rain or snow can inflict harm on a house's gutter. High winds can also cause rain gutters to become loose or detach from rooflines.
Moreover, descending rubbish caused by weather conditions can lead to sagging, damaged, or otherwise harmed rain gutters.
Routine check-ups and cleansing can help forestall weather harm from worsening into larger problems over time.

Are Rain Gutter Accessories Essential?
Some gutter attachments can assist boost the longevity and operability of a residence's gutters.
For example, gutter guards assist by avoiding waste from clogging rain gutters.
Downspout additions, on the other hand, support direct water even further away from a house's footing.
You can also think about other add-ons but be sure to choose them according to your needs and budget.
